Transaction f8f66af3c9fd3069d0cdf95d2d53e5a23f256b8e1cc610a417c37b33a1847880

1 Input
2 Outputs
  • f8f66af3c9fd3069d0cdf95d2d53e5a23f256b8e1cc610a417c37b33a1847880:0
  • value  2613700
    address  1F3oG33yDJnWKDVhVAdwFhAp1oHz5Qo6DV
  • f8f66af3c9fd3069d0cdf95d2d53e5a23f256b8e1cc610a417c37b33a1847880:1
  • value  25140293
    address  3MbFo2Lz9Q77ENdunGXRW5FNoVsjRbeHTD